Проектирование процессора ЭВМ на секционированных микропроцессорных БИС. Гурин Е.И - 25 стр.

UptoLike

Для чтения, записи и модификации микрокоманды используется
команда W, по которой выводится в первой строке разметка адреса и полей
микрокоманды, а во второй - выводится адрес открытой ячейки и
последовательно вводятся коды всех полей микрокоманды. Для ввода кода
поля набирается восьмеричный его код и нажимается клавиша Enter, затем
маркер дисплея автоматически перемещается в соседнее поле.
Команды < и > являются комплексными и закрывают ранее открытую
ячейку, открывают следующую большим или соответственно с меньшим
адресом и читают ее содержимое).
Команда M[Fild] позволяет модифицировать одно из полей открытой
ячейки. При этом вместе с командой М необходимо ввести номер ячейки,
которую надо исправить.
Команда Z очищает ПЗУ, т.е. записывает во все ячейки коды 0.
Пользоваться этой командой следует осторожно.
Команда L выводит оператору либо на принтер L[P], либо на терминал
L[T], либо в файл L[F] листинг микропрограммы, записанной в ПЗУ. При
этом содержимое ячеек с кодом 0 не выводится. Чтобы указать, на какое
устройство выводить листинг, необходимо на запрос кросс-системы ввести
буквы: P (принтер), T (экран) или F (файл). В последнем случае листинг
выводится в файл с именем, указанным в начале программы без расширения.
Если оператору необходимо прочитать файл в ПЗУ по заданному
адресу, то это необходимо сделать с помощью команды F[L].
Для того, чтобы сохранить части ПЗУ в файле, надо ввести F[S]. Затем
вводить начальный, конечный адреса и имя файла (до восьми знаков ) , куда
запишется ПЗУ. Лучше это выполнять периодически, чтобы обеспечить
автоматическую сохранность вводимой микропрограммы при случайном
нарушении работы ЭВМ.
Моделирование подготовленной микропрограммы выполняется под
управлением команд: В, G, Р, S, D, I и O.
Установка начальных параметров модели выполняется по команде В, по
которой последовательно вводятся: начальный и конечный адреса
выполняемого участка микропрограммы, количество тактов моделирования
(десятичное, число, равное ориентировочной длительности выполнения
микропрограммы для предотвращения зацикливания).
23
     Для чтения, записи и модификации микрокоманды используется
команда W, по которой выводится в первой строке разметка адреса и полей
микрокоманды, а во второй - выводится адрес открытой ячейки и
последовательно вводятся коды всех полей микрокоманды. Для ввода кода
поля набирается восьмеричный его код и нажимается клавиша Enter, затем
маркер дисплея автоматически перемещается в соседнее поле.
     Команды < и > являются комплексными и закрывают ранее открытую
ячейку, открывают следующую (с большим или соответственно с меньшим
адресом и читают ее содержимое).
     Команда M[Fild] позволяет модифицировать одно из полей открытой
ячейки. При этом вместе с командой М необходимо ввести номер ячейки,
которую надо исправить.
     Команда Z очищает ПЗУ, т.е. записывает во все ячейки коды 0.
Пользоваться этой командой следует осторожно.
     Команда L выводит оператору либо на принтер L[P], либо на терминал
L[T], либо в файл L[F] листинг микропрограммы, записанной в ПЗУ. При
этом содержимое ячеек с кодом 0 не выводится. Чтобы указать, на какое
устройство выводить листинг, необходимо на запрос кросс-системы ввести
буквы: P (принтер), T (экран) или F (файл). В последнем случае листинг
выводится в файл с именем, указанным в начале программы без расширения.
     Если оператору необходимо прочитать файл в ПЗУ по заданному
адресу, то это необходимо сделать с помощью команды F[L].
     Для того, чтобы сохранить части ПЗУ в файле, надо ввести F[S]. Затем
вводить начальный, конечный адреса и имя файла (до восьми знаков ) , куда
запишется ПЗУ. Лучше это выполнять периодически, чтобы обеспечить
автоматическую сохранность вводимой микропрограммы при случайном
нарушении работы ЭВМ.
     Моделирование подготовленной микропрограммы выполняется под
управлением команд: В, G, Р, S, D, I и O.
     Установка начальных параметров модели выполняется по команде В, по
которой последовательно вводятся: начальный и конечный адреса
выполняемого участка микропрограммы, количество тактов моделирования
(десятичное, число, равное ориентировочной длительности выполнения
микропрограммы для предотвращения зацикливания).




                                   23